Snow report Montafon, 12/06/2020

Snow condition
Closed snow cover from 1000m. From 1500 m it starts. From then on, more or less constant up to the very top, and from 2000 m upwards, snow from the last periods of precipitation is still there, but you always have to reckon with ground contact. Piste and meadow are fine, I would leave the rest.
Snow quality
Good snow. About 30-40cm has fallen since Fri. As it's not too cold, the snow is relatively wet. It's mostly too flat where you can ski, and since there were about 1000 tourers in Gargellen, the whole mountain is covered in tracks. A lot of snow has come loose. Skiing is only recommended to a limited extent.
Risks
Beware of stones. That is dangerous. Exciting slopes are not yet possible anyway, and I would stay away from steep north-facing slopes.
Overall impression
A good start and a little exercise. More is not yet possible.
